Patrick Nip Tak-kuen, Hong Kong secretary for the civil service, told China Daily on Thursday that a policy requiring new civil servants to take an oath of allegiance to the Hong Kong Special Administrative Region will be introduced in early October.
Nip said it has always been the duty of Hong Kong civil servants to uphold the Basic Law and promise their allegiance to the SAR.
